WebHistory, current events, and societal events have all inspired American literature. The world around them affects and influences authors, their literary works, and unique writing styles. Writing styles are also influenced by the current trends and beliefs of the time period. WebJul 23, 2024 · History often shapes how we see ourselves in relation to the future. It can influence our beliefs about the possibilities and probabilities of certain events, and our expectations for how our society will change.
